本发明涉及电动汽车零部件诊断,尤其涉及一种继电器诊断方法、设备及存储介质。
背景技术:
1、继电器是电动汽车高压系统的重要部件,闭合高压继电器,可以将电池包的高压输出给其它高压部件(如电机、空调等),才能让高压部件正常工作。因此继电器的正常工作,是整个电动汽车正常工作的关键。出于以上考虑,继电器的诊断技术十分重要。
2、现有的继电器诊断方法为高压诊断,即发出继电器闭合指令后,再通过检测继电器前后两端的电压是否一致,判断继电器是否闭合。该方法判断的准确度高,但是该方法检测速度较慢,一般是继电器发出闭合指令后200ms内完成判断,并不能事先判断。
技术实现思路
1、本发明提供了一种继电器诊断方法、设备及存储介质,以实现对继电器故障的诊断,并且能够提前判断是否发生故障。
2、根据本发明的一方面,提供了一种继电器诊断方法,该继电器诊断方法应用于继电器诊断电路,所述继电器诊断电路包括:继电器、设置在所述继电器第一端与电源端之间的第一开关、设置在所述继电器第二端与接地端之间的第二开关;
3、所述方法包括:
4、通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障。
5、可选地,所述通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障,包括:
6、在所述继电器闭合指令发出之前,和/或在所述继电器闭合指令发出之后,通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障。
7、可选地,所述通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障,包括:
8、控制所述第一开关闭合且所述第二开关断开,检测所述继电器第一端的第一电压是否满足第一预设电压条件,以判断是否发生高边驱动线路故障;
9、控制所述第一开关断开且所述第二开关闭合,检测所述继电器第二端的第二电压是否满足第二预设电压条件,以判断是否发生低边驱动线路故障。
10、可选地,所述第一预设电压条件为:是否在第一预设电压范围内;
11、所述第二预设电压条件为:是否在第二预设电压范围内。
12、可选地,在所述继电器闭合指令发出之前通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障,包括:
13、以预设周期循环执行通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足所述预设条件,以判断是否发生驱动线路故障的操作。
14、可选地,该继电器诊断方法还包括:若未发生驱动线路故障,控制所述第一开关和所述第二开关闭合,且在所述继电器后端高压未建立时,检测所述继电器第二端与接地端之间的电流情况,并根据所述继电器第二端与接地端之间的电流情况判断是发生继电器本体故障还是蓄电池功率不足故障。
15、可选地,所述若未发生驱动线路故障,控制所述第一开关和所述第二开关闭合,且在所述继电器后端高压未建立时,检测所述继电器第二端与接地端之间的电流情况,并根据所述继电器第二端与接地端之间的电流情况判断是发生继电器本体故障还是蓄电池功率不足故障,包括:
16、若未发生驱动线路故障,控制所述第一开关和所述第二开关闭合,且在所述继电器后端高压未建立时,若所述继电器第二端与接地端之间的电流情况满足第一预设电流情况时,则发生蓄电池功率不足故障;
17、若所述继电器第二端与接地端之间的电流情况满足第二预设电流情况时,则发生继电器本体故障。
18、可选地,所述第一预设电流情况为:检测到所述继电器第二端与接地端之间有电流存在,且电流小于所述继电器正常工作电流;
19、所述第二预设电流情况为:检测到所述继电器第二端与接地端之间有电流存在,且电流为继电器正常工作电流。
20、根据本发明的另一方面,提供了一种诊断设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如第一方面所述的继电器诊断方法。
21、根据本发明的另一方面,提供了一种包含计算机可执行指令的存储介质,其特征在于,所述计算机可执行指令在由计算机处理器执行时用于执行如第一方面所述的继电器诊断方法。
22、本发明实施例的技术方案,通过提供一种继电器诊断方法、设备及存储介质,该继电器诊断方法应用于继电器诊断电路,继电器诊断电路包括:继电器、设置在继电器第一端与电源端之间的第一开关、设置在继电器第二端与接地端之间的第二开关;该继电器诊断方法包括:通过控制第一开关和第二开关单独闭合检测继电器第一端的第一电压和继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障。由此可知,通过该方法可以实现对继电器驱动线路故障进行诊断。且与现有技术必须要发出继电器闭合指令才能进行检测的方式相比,该诊断方法对继电器闭合指令是否发出并无特定要求,使用场景灵活,操作简单,适用性强,并且能够事先诊断是否发生驱动线路故障。
23、应当理解,本部分所描述的内容并非旨在标识本发明的实施例的关键或重要特征,也不用于限制本发明的范围。本发明的其它特征将通过以下的说明书而变得容易理解。
1.一种继电器诊断方法,其特征在于,应用于继电器诊断电路,所述继电器诊断电路包括:继电器、设置在所述继电器第一端与电源端之间的第一开关、设置在所述继电器第二端与接地端之间的第二开关;
2.根据权利要求1所述的继电器诊断方法,其特征在于,所述通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障,包括:
3.根据权利要求1或2所述的继电器诊断方法,其特征在于,所述通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障,包括:
4.根据权利要求3所述的继电器诊断方法,其特征在于,所述第一预设电压条件为:是否在第一预设电压范围内;
5.根据权利要求2所述的继电器诊断方法,其特征在于,在所述继电器闭合指令发出之前通过控制所述第一开关和所述第二开关单独闭合检测所述继电器第一端的第一电压和所述继电器第二端的第二电压是否满足预设条件,以判断是否发生驱动线路故障,包括:
6.根据权利要求1或2所述的继电器诊断方法,其特征在于,还包括:若未发生驱动线路故障,控制所述第一开关和所述第二开关闭合,且在所述继电器后端高压未建立时,检测所述继电器第二端与接地端之间的电流情况,并根据所述继电器第二端与接地端之间的电流情况判断是发生继电器本体故障还是蓄电池功率不足故障。
7.根据权利要求6所述的继电器诊断方法,其特征在于,所述若未发生驱动线路故障,控制所述第一开关和所述第二开关闭合,且在所述继电器后端高压未建立时,检测所述继电器第二端与接地端之间的电流情况,并根据所述继电器第二端与接地端之间的电流情况判断是发生继电器本体故障还是蓄电池功率不足故障,包括:
8.根据权利要求7所述的继电器诊断方法,其特征在于,所述第一预设电流情况为:检测到所述继电器第二端与接地端之间有电流存在,且电流小于所述继电器正常工作电流;
9.一种诊断设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,其特征在于,所述处理器执行所述程序时实现如权利要求1-8中任一所述的继电器诊断方法。
10.一种包含计算机可执行指令的存储介质,其特征在于,所述计算机可执行指令在由计算机处理器执行时用于执行如权利要求1-8中任一所述的继电器诊断方法。